Definitive design and deployment guide for secure virtual private network Learn about IPSec protocols and Cisco IOS IPSec packet processing Understand the differences between IPSec tunnel mode and transport mode IPSec VPN Evaluating features that improve scalability and fault tolerance, such as dead peer detection and control plane keepalives Overcoming the challenges of working with NAT and IPSec remote-PMTUD Explore access features, including extended authentication, mode-configuration, and digital certificates Check the pros and cons of various IPSec connection models such as native IPSec, GRE, and remote access Apply fault tolerance methods to IPSec VPN designs employing a mechanism to reduce the complexity scale IPSec VPN configuration large, including Tunnel End-Point Discovery (TED) and Dynamic Multipoint VPN (DMVPN) Add services to IPSec VPNs, including voice and multicast Understand how network-based VPNs operate and how to integrate IPSec VPNs with MPLS VPNs Among the many functions that networking technologies permit is the ability for organizations to easily and securely communicate with branch offices, mobile users, telecommuters, and business partners. VPN provides enhanced productivity, efficient and remote access to network resources, site-to-site connectivity, high security, and tremendous cost savings. IPSec VPN Design is the first book that presents a detailed examination of the design aspects of IPSec VPN protocols that enable secure communications. Part II discusses the design principles include IPSec VPN hub-and-spoke, full-mesh, and fault-tolerant design. This part of this book also shows you how to integrate IPSec VPNs with MPLS VPNs. IPSec VPN Design provides you with field-tested design and configuration advice to help you deploy a safe and effective VPN solution in any environment. Security book is part of the Cisco Press Networking Technology Series.
